ethical ai practices

Ethical AI practices involve developing artificial intelligence technologies that prioritize fairness, transparency, and accountability, ensuring they do not perpetuate biases or harm to individuals or communities. These practices often include implementing robust data privacy measures, creating AI systems that can explain their decision-making processes, and involving diverse teams to reduce bias. By adhering to ethical guidelines, AI developers can foster trust and create technologies that enhance societal well-being while minimizing potential risks.

Get started

Millions of flashcards designed to help you ace your studies

Sign up for free

Review generated flashcards

Sign up for free
You have reached the daily AI limit

Start learning or create your own AI flashcards

StudySmarter Editorial Team

Team ethical ai practices Teachers

  • 12 minutes reading time
  • Checked by StudySmarter Editorial Team
Save Article Save Article
Contents
Contents
Table of contents

    Jump to a key chapter

      Definition of Ethical AI in Engineering

      Understanding ethical AI practices in engineering is fundamental for ensuring that artificial intelligence technologies are developed and implemented responsibly. Ethical AI refers to designing and utilizing AI systems in a manner consistent with moral values and societal norms. This responsibility includes making sure AI systems are fair, transparent, and accountable.

      Key Concepts in Ethical AI

      When discussing ethical AI, several key concepts emerge as vital for engineers and developers:

      • Fairness: Ensuring AI does not perpetuate bias or discrimination.
      • Transparency: Making AI systems understandable and open for scrutiny.
      • Accountability: Holding creators and operators of AI systems responsible for their impact.
      • Privacy: Protecting user data against misuse.
      • Safety: Guaranteeing AI systems do not cause harm.

      These principles are essential in mitigating the negative consequences of AI technology. By incorporating these ethical standards, engineers promote trust and acceptance of AI systems in society.

      An example of fairness in AI can be seen in recruitment software. By integrating measures that reduce bias, these systems aim to provide equal opportunities for all applicants, regardless of race, gender, or background.

      Transparency in AI can often be achieved by using algorithms that are explainable, meaning their decisions can be traced and understood easily.

      Ethical AI and Its Role in Engineering

      Ethical AI plays a pivotal role in engineering as it guides the development of AI systems that align with societal values. Here's how it impacts different aspects:

      DesignEthical considerations shape the design of AI systems, ensuring they are inclusive and unbiased.
      ImplementationDuring deployment, ethical AI dictates the manner and context in which the technology is used.
      RegulationGovernment policies frequently align with ethical AI principles to regulate AI technologies.
      EducationTraining programs include ethical AI to prepare future engineers to address complex ethical dilemmas.

      Through these areas, ethical AI influences not only how AI solutions are created but also how they are perceived and governed. By integrating ethical practices, engineers can ensure AI initiatives are sustainable and beneficial in the long term.

      An interesting deep dive into ethical AI involves exploring the concept of AI auditing. This is an emerging practice where external audits are conducted to assess compliance with ethical standards. AI auditing involves reviewing system processes, evaluating bias levels, and checking data privacy measures.

      Furthermore, AI systems developers may volunteer their algorithms for independent audits to enhance transparency and trust among users. This practice is becoming increasingly common among tech companies aiming to dispel criticisms and promote an ethical, customer-focused approach.

      Ethical Considerations in AI Algorithms

      AI algorithms are powerful tools that influence many aspects of modern life, from social media feeds to criminal justice systems. To ensure these systems serve society positively, ethical considerations are paramount.

      Identifying Bias in AI Algorithms

      Identifying bias in AI algorithms is essential to maintaining fairness and accuracy. Bias can creep into algorithms through various means, often reflecting or amplifying existing societal inequalities.

      Common types of bias include:

      • Data Bias: Occurs when the data used to train algorithms is unrepresentative or flawed.
      • Algorithmic Bias: Emerges from the design choices made by programmers.
      • User Bias: Results when the behavior of users interacts with the system in prejudicial ways.

      Recognizing these biases is the first step toward rectifying them. Engineers can employ strategies like regular auditing and diverse data sampling to minimize these biases.

      Bias in AI refers to systematic error in an AI algorithm's output that impacts certain groups unfairly based on characteristics like race, gender, or socio-economic status.

      An example of bias is when facial recognition software performs significantly better for certain ethnic groups due to an imbalance in training data. Addressing this requires diversifying datasets and refining algorithmic parameters.

      Conducting blind testing can help reveal biases within AI systems by anonymizing identity factors during testing phases.

      Let's take a deeper look into the concept of algorithmic auditing as a tool for bias identification. Algorithmic audits evaluate the processes and decisions within AI systems to ensure compliance with ethical standards.

      This involves:

      • Analyzing datasets for representation.
      • Testing model outcomes for discriminatory patterns.
      • Reviewing code for biased logic or assumptions.

      Increasingly, companies are integrating auditing mechanisms within their AI development pipelines to enhance fairness and reduce unintended consequences.

      Fairness and Transparency in AI Algorithms

      Achieving fairness and transparency within AI algorithms is a critical goal that ensures equitable treatment and accountability. Fairness involves creating systems that provide unbiased outcomes, while transparency refers to the openness in system processes and decision-making.

      To enhance these principles, engineers can implement the following practices:

      • Documenting Processes: Keeping detailed records of datasets and algorithmic changes.
      • Explainable AI: Developing models that provide understandable rationale for their decisions.
      • User Feedback: Involving user input to steer algorithm development and identify issues early.

      Ensuring transparency allows stakeholders to trust AI technologies, knowing how they function and affect results.

      For example, a banking application implementing transparent practices might display the key factors influencing whether a loan has been approved or denied, thus demystifying its decision-making process for users.

      Transparency in AI ensures that AI operations are accessible and understandable to users and stakeholders, facilitating accountability and trust.

      A fascinating deep dive into transparent AI involves the concept of Open Algorithms, where users are provided access to the code that processes their data, allowing assessment and modification. This approach encourages community engagement and collaborative innovation.

      Techniques for Ensuring Ethical AI Practices

      Implementing ethical AI practices involves various techniques and strategies to ensure AI systems are responsible and fair. These techniques provide frameworks for engineers to develop AI that adheres to ethical standards.

      Ethical AI Implementation in Engineering

      In engineering, ethical AI implementation is critical for designing AI systems that align with established ethical guidelines. This process involves integrating ethical considerations into every stage of AI development.

      Key strategies for ethical implementation include:

      • Inclusive Design: Engage diverse teams to minimize bias and represent varied perspectives during the design phase.
      • Regular Audits: Conduct periodic reviews of AI systems to check for bias and ensure compliance with ethical standards.
      • User-Centric Approach: Involve end-users in the development process to align AI functionalities with user needs and ethical expectations.
      • Continuous Feedback: Establish mechanisms for ongoing feedback from users and stakeholders to refine and adjust AI systems accordingly.

      These methods ensure AI systems are not only technically sound but also ethically accountable.

      An example of ethical AI implementation is found in self-driving cars, where diverse data from various road scenarios is used to train models, ensuring the AI is equipped to make fair and safe decisions on a global scale.

      Applying ethical frameworks in AI projects can often involve utilizing established models like the IEEE Global Initiative on Ethics of Autonomous and Intelligent Systems.

      A deeper exploration into ethical AI implementation explores the concept of AI Ethics Committees. These committees oversee and guide the ethical dimensions of AI projects within organizations. Responsibilities include:

      • Examining ethical challenges and providing recommendations.
      • Reviewing AI system impacts on vulnerable populations.
      • Ensuring transparency and accountability in AI development.

      By institutionalizing such bodies, organizations commit to maintaining ethical standards throughout AI systems' lifecycles.

      Monitoring and Evaluation Tools for Ethical AI

      Monitoring and evaluating ethical AI is crucial to ensure ongoing compliance with ethical guidelines. Key tools and methodologies assist developers and engineers in assessing AI systems' performances ethically.

      Important tools for evaluation include:

      • Algorithmic Auditing Tools: Software that identifies and mitigates bias in AI algorithms.
      • Impact Assessment Frameworks: Evaluates the social, economic, and environmental effects of AI deployments.
      • Transparency Logs: Records decision-making processes and rationale within AI algorithms for accountability.

      These tools enable engineers to maintain transparent and fair AI systems, fostering user trust and acceptance.

      For instance, an algorithmic auditing tool might scan a recommendation engine for biases, ensuring that movie suggestions are not skewed towards specific demographics.

      Regularly updating AI evaluation tools can help adapt to new ethical challenges and stay compliant with evolving legal requirements.

      An exciting deep dive involves examining Explanability Dashboards. These dashboards provide users with comprehensive insights into how AI systems make decisions, showcasing visual representations of decision processes and factors influencing outcomes. Such tools promote user understanding and transparency in AI operations.

      Importance of Ethical AI Standards in Engineering

      Ethical AI standards play a crucial role in engineering by setting benchmarks that ensure AI technologies are used responsibly. These standards guide engineers in creating systems that are not only innovative but also considerate of moral and societal implications. Establishing robust ethical frameworks is essential for aligning AI development with values like fairness, transparency, and accountability.

      Developing Ethical AI Policies

      When developing ethical AI policies, it's important to establish clear guidelines that govern the creation, implementation, and use of AI technologies. These policies are foundational in ensuring AI systems operate within socially acceptable boundaries.

      Key steps in policy development include:

      • Identifying Core Values: Define the ethical principles to prioritize such as privacy, equity, and non-discrimination.
      • Engaging Stakeholders: Collaborate with industry experts, regulators, and the public to gather diverse insights and perspectives.
      • Creating a Regulatory Framework: Develop legal guidelines that mandate ethical compliance and accountability.
      • Continuous Review and Updating: Periodically revisit policies to address emerging ethical challenges and technological advancements.

      By following these steps, organizations can cultivate AI systems that reflect ethical integrity and social responsibility.

      Ethical AI Policies refer to structured guidelines that dictate the responsible and fair use and development of AI systems, ensuring alignment with societal and moral expectations.

      An implementation of ethical AI policies could involve a tech company establishing a code of ethics that dictates the handling of user data, requiring explicit consent before data collection.

      Involving legal experts when drafting AI policies can help ensure compliance with existing laws and reduce potential legal liabilities.

      An engaging deep dive into policy development examines the role of international coalitions like UNESCO in fostering global ethical AI standards. These coalitions work to harmonize ethical practices across borders, creating universal guidelines that enhance the interoperability and ethical accountability of AI technologies worldwide.

      A Practical Guide to Building Ethical AI

      Constructing ethical AI systems requires a strategic approach with attention to detail at every development stage. This guide provides a practical outline for engineers looking to embed ethical principles into AI solutions.

      Essential steps include:

      • Conducting Ethical Assessments: Evaluate the potential ethical risks and impacts associated with AI applications.
      • Adopting Ethical Design Practices: Implement design principles that account for inclusion, accessibility, and minimization of bias.
      • Training with Diverse Datasets: Use broad and varied data to train AI models, reducing risk of systemic bias.
      • Ensuring Transparency and Explainability: Develop AI systems whose decision-making processes can be easily understood and communicated.

      These practices not only promote ethical AI development but also enhance the functionality and reliability of AI technologies.

      For instance, an online platform creating a recommendation engine might apply ethical design by ensuring suggestions are based on user diversity and fairness, preventing overexposure to biased content.

      Ethical AI Systems are AI technologies designed and operated in a way that adheres to moral guidelines and societal norms, promoting fairness, accountability, and transparency.

      Exploring further, AI ethics toolkits are emerging resources in building ethical AI. These toolkits provide engineers with comprehensive resources that include checklists, case studies, and implementation strategies tailored to specific ethical challenges - helping streamline the integration of ethics into different AI applications.

      ethical ai practices - Key takeaways

      • Ethical AI Practices: Designing and utilizing AI systems respecting moral values, ensuring fairness, transparency, accountability, privacy, and safety.
      • Definition of Ethical AI in Engineering: Creating AI technologies consistently with moral values and societal norms.
      • Ethical Considerations in AI Algorithms: Ensuring algorithms maintain fairness and accuracy, avoiding biases like data, algorithmic, and user bias.
      • Ethical AI Implementation in Engineering: Involves the incorporation of ethical standards into design, deployment, and regulation.
      • Techniques for Ensuring Ethical AI Practices: Inclusive design, regular audits, user feedback, and continuous monitoring to align AI systems with ethical guidelines.
      • Importance of Ethical AI Standards in Engineering: Providing benchmarks for responsible AI use, fostering trust, and ensuring societal alignment.
      Frequently Asked Questions about ethical ai practices
      How can engineers ensure that AI systems are designed with ethical considerations in mind?
      Engineers can ensure that AI systems are designed with ethical considerations by incorporating ethical guidelines early in the development process, conducting regular audits for bias and fairness, ensuring transparency and accountability, and engaging with diverse stakeholders to understand and address potential ethical concerns.
      What are some common ethical challenges faced in AI engineering?
      Common ethical challenges in AI engineering include bias in algorithms, lack of transparency and explainability, data privacy and security concerns, accountability for AI decisions, and ensuring AI systems do not exacerbate inequality or harm. Balancing innovation with ethical compliance is crucial in addressing these challenges.
      What strategies can be implemented to mitigate bias in AI algorithms?
      To mitigate bias in AI algorithms, implement diverse and representative data collection, employ fairness-aware algorithms, regularly audit and test models for bias, and involve interdisciplinary teams to evaluate AI systems from multiple perspectives. Continuous feedback and updates are also crucial to maintaining fairness and reducing bias.
      How can AI engineers ensure transparency in their systems?
      AI engineers can ensure transparency by designing systems with clear documentation, utilizing interpretable machine learning models, providing access to code and data where possible, and implementing explainability tools to make algorithmic decisions understandable to users and stakeholders.
      How can effective monitoring and evaluation of AI systems contribute to ethical AI practices?
      Effective monitoring and evaluation of AI systems ensure alignment with ethical standards, identify biases or unintended consequences, promote transparency, and improve accountability. This helps maintain trust, adapt to societal norms, and safeguard against harm, facilitating responsible and ethical AI deployment.
      Save Article

      Test your knowledge with multiple choice flashcards

      What is the primary goal of ethical AI practices in engineering?

      What is bias in AI algorithms?

      What does AI auditing involve?

      Next

      Discover learning materials with the free StudySmarter app

      Sign up for free
      1
      About StudySmarter

      StudySmarter is a globally recognized educational technology company, offering a holistic learning platform designed for students of all ages and educational levels. Our platform provides learning support for a wide range of subjects, including STEM, Social Sciences, and Languages and also helps students to successfully master various tests and exams worldwide, such as GCSE, A Level, SAT, ACT, Abitur, and more. We offer an extensive library of learning materials, including interactive flashcards, comprehensive textbook solutions, and detailed explanations. The cutting-edge technology and tools we provide help students create their own learning materials. StudySmarter’s content is not only expert-verified but also regularly updated to ensure accuracy and relevance.

      Learn more
      StudySmarter Editorial Team

      Team Engineering Teachers

      • 12 minutes reading time
      • Checked by StudySmarter Editorial Team
      Save Explanation Save Explanation

      Study anywhere. Anytime.Across all devices.

      Sign-up for free

      Sign up to highlight and take notes. It’s 100% free.

      Join over 22 million students in learning with our StudySmarter App

      The first learning app that truly has everything you need to ace your exams in one place

      • Flashcards & Quizzes
      • AI Study Assistant
      • Study Planner
      • Mock-Exams
      • Smart Note-Taking
      Join over 22 million students in learning with our StudySmarter App
      Sign up with Email